Day 01: Kathmandu to Kyirung (185km) In the morning, we will pick you up from your hotel in Kathmandu, and you will be driven along a small mountain road toward the border on the Nepalese side. You will enjoy scenic views of waterfalls, rivers, gorges, and forests on the way. Finally, you will arrive at Kyirung and check in at your hotel. You can spend the rest of the day exploring the small town and acclimatizing to the altitude. Meals: Breakfast Accommodation: Hotel in Kyirung
Day 02: Kyirung to Tingri (370km) You will cross the Nepalese border early in the morning and meet your Tibetan tour guide. You will then be transferred from Kyirung to Old Tingri (4,300m), while enjoying beautiful views of the borderline and snow-capped mountains. As you pass Tongla Pass (5,100m), you can appreciate the epic mountain vista of the Himalayan range. You will arrive in Tingri in the evening and check in at your guesthouse. Meals: Breakfast Accommodation: Guesthouse in Tingri
Day 03: Tingri to Ronbuk (335km) to Shigatse After breakfast, you will drive to Ronbuk (5,200m) and hike around Everest Base Camp. The hike to the base camp takes around 2 hours, and you can enjoy stunning views of the Himalayan range, including the world's highest peak, Mount Everest (8,848m). Afterward, you will drive to Shigatse (3,900m) and check in at your hotel. Meals: Breakfast Accommodation: Hotel in Shigatse
Day 04: Shigatse to Gyantse (90km) After breakfast, you will visit Panchen Lama's Tashilhumpu Monastery, one of the six Gelug monasteries known for its giant statue of Maitreya Buddha. Then you will drive to Gyantse (3,950m), a historic town famous for its Kumbum Stupa, a unique structure that houses 108 chapels with thousands of murals and statues. You will also visit Phalkhor Monastery, a remarkable monastery that represents the harmonious coexistence of different sects of Tibetan Buddhism. Meals: Breakfast Accommodation: Hotel in Gyantse
Day 05: Gyantse to Lhasa (261km) After breakfast, you will embark on a full day of picturesque driving. You will cross over Karola (5,010m) and Kambala (4,749m) passes and enjoy stunning views of the Himalayan range. You will also visit the colorful Yamdrok-Tso Lake, considered one of Tibet's four holy lakes. Finally, you will cross the Tibetan lifeline river Brahma Putra (Yarlung Tsangpo) and arrive in Lhasa (3,600m) in the evening. You will check in at your hotel and rest for the night. Meals: Breakfast Accommodation: Hotel in Lhasa
Day 06: Sightseeing in Lhasa After breakfast, you will have a full day to explore the fascinating city of Lhasa. You will visit Jokhang Temple, which is considered the holiest temple in Tibet and a major pilgrimage site. You will also explore Barkhor Bazaar, a traditional market that surrounds the temple, where you can find a wide variety of traditional Tibetan goods such as jewelry, clothing, and handicrafts. In the afternoon, you will visit the iconic Potala Palace, the former residence of the Dalai Lama. This palace is perched on a hill overlooking Lhasa and is a stunning example of Tibetan architecture. You will also visit Drepung Monastery, which was once the largest monastery in the world, and Sera Monastery, famous for its lively debates among monks. Meals: Breakfast Stay overnight at your hotel in Lhasa.
Day 07: Sightseeing in Lhasa Today you will continue your exploration of Lhasa with another full day of sightseeing. You can revisit any of the sites you particularly enjoyed from the previous day, or explore new sites such as Norbulingka, the summer residence of the Dalai Lama, or Ganden Monastery, one of the three great Gelug University monasteries of Tibet. In the evening, you can relax and enjoy a traditional Tibetan dinner or explore more of the local culture and nightlife. Meals: Breakfast Stay overnight at your hotel in Lhasa.
Day 08: Lhasa to Shigatse After breakfast, you will depart Lhasa and drive to Shigatse, the second-largest city in Tibet. On the way, you will enjoy the stunning scenery of the Tibetan Plateau and pass through small towns and villages. In Shigatse, you will visit the Panchen Lama’s Tashilhumpu Monastery, a major Gelug monastery that is one of the six great monasteries of Tibet. You can explore the monastery complex, which includes several impressive temples, and learn more about the history and culture of Tibet. Meals: Breakfast Stay overnight at your hotel in Shigatse.
Day 09: Shigatse to Kerung After breakfast, you will drive back to Kerung, the last town on the Tibetan side of the border. Along the way, you can enjoy the scenic views of the Tibetan countryside and stop to take photos or stretch your legs. In Kerung, you can relax and enjoy a final night in Tibet, perhaps taking the opportunity to reflect on your amazing journey. Meals: Breakfast Stay overnight at your hotel in Kerung.
Day 10: Kerung to Kathmandu After breakfast, your tour guide will assist you in exiting China and see you off at the Gyirong border. From there, you will drive back to Kathmandu, where you will arrive in the afternoon.
